The right web design directly influences customer perception. A disjointed, slow, or confusing website can quickly erode trust, causing visitors to abandon their purchase journey.

Problem: Many ecommerce businesses underestimate the value of seamless site experiences. Common pitfalls include unclear navigation, slow page loads, or inconsistent branding across pages.

Solution: Prioritise responsive layouts and clear hierarchies. Ensure your main navigation is intuitive and accessible from every device. Choose reliable hosting solutions for fast load times. Use high-definition images that represent your products accurately and reinforce your brand’s visual identity.

Accessibility is another key factor for Australian ecommerce. Follow WCAG guidelines for readability, contrast, and keyboard navigation so everyone can access your site easily.

Beyond aesthetics, usability drives conversion. A clutter-free design with strategically placed calls to action can direct visitors toward key products or promotions without overwhelming them. White space isn’t wasted space; it lets your content and visuals breathe, making your site more inviting.

Social proof elements—such as customer reviews, trust badges, and testimonials—should feature prominently on product pages and throughout your checkout flow. These elements boost perceived credibility and ease buying anxiety from new customers.

Continually monitor site analytics. Identify friction points by tracking drop-off rates on key pages and test different layouts to enhance performance. Australian shoppers value transparency and local credibility, so clearly display shipping information, returns policies, and local support options.

Future-proof your web design by staying updated on best practices. Invest in regular audits, performance benchmarks, and accessibility checks, especially as regulations or audience needs change.
